About Entrepreneurship Management
Entrepreneurial
management as the practice of taking entrepreneurial knowledge and
utilizing it for increasing the effectiveness of new business venturing
as well as small- and medium-sized businesses.
Why is Entrepreneurship Management important?
The
entrepreneurial ventures are such organizations that explore
opportunities through having three factors in hand, i.e. innovative
skills, constant growth and profitability.
